  • In the context of the deep integration of the digital governance wave and educational digitalization strategies, artificial intelligence (AI) presents a historic opportunity for the paradigm shift in the construction of university student Party branches. Grounded in digital governance theory, this paper systematically explores the connotation evolution, logical mechanisms, and practical pathways of AI-empowered construction of university student Party branches. This study believes that empowering the construction of university student Party branches with artificial intelligence, in essence, is to use AI methods to address the issue of how student Party branches can achieve a governance transformation from standardized management to precise education under conditions of high member turnover and active thinking among young Party members; AI empowerment is mainly reflected in the evolution of connotations in three dimensions: organization, function, and system; its internal logic lies in the deepening of concepts driven by educational goals, the optimization of mechanisms driven by information needs, and the upgrading of paradigms driven by quality objectives. On this basis, this study constructs a closed-loop practical pathway characterized by precise evaluation to guide direction, data fusion to consolidate the foundation, institutional norms to ensure operation, and a human-centered orientation to realize value, thereby providing theoretical reference and practical guidance for improving the quality of Party construction among university students in the new era.
